Join us in our mission to conduct groundbreaking research on New Guinea Singing Dogs (NGSDs) – an ancient lineage with profound implications for evolutionary biology, animal behavior, and human-animal relationships. At the New Guinea Singing Dog Conservation Society, we're committed to fostering collaborative partnerships with academics and researchers to explore a wide range of topics related to NGSDs, both in North America and abroad.
